    Former WBC lightweight champion Antonio DeMarco (30-3-1, 23KOs) continued the road back, with a second round drilling of Jesus Gurrola (20-6) at the Casino Hipodromo Agua Caliente in Tijuana, Baja California, Mexico. Hall of Fame trainer Freddie Roach was working with DeMarco, as Juan Manuel Marquez was watching from ringside. DeMarco gets his second victory since a TKO defeat to Adrien Broner.
